Results from 2019 English

Association Survey- Saint Paul


Institute
In 2019, Saint Paul Institute hosted a volunteer from the University of Notre Dame
Australia for two months. The English Association was formed as a weekly club for
students to develop their listening and speaking skills alongside a native speaker
from Australia. Students were given the opportunity to complete an optional survey
at the end of the program about their experiences in the English Association. These
are the results.

Number of Participants: 12

6) Do you feel more confident speaking English now?


 64% of respondents claimed that they felt more confident speaking English
after participating in the English Association.
 29% of students did not feel more confident and 7% were unsure.

7) Rate English Association out of 5 stars.


 60% of respondents rated the program as 4 stars or above.
 30% of respondents rated the program as 3 stars.
 7% of respondents rated the program as 1 star.
